Future UAV Industry Trends (2025–2030)

The drone industry is shifting from manually operated tools into autonomous infrastructure systems. High-capacity battery swap docks and edge AI computing are leading this transition.

Automated Battery Swap Docks: Automated installations like the GUD K01 enable automated charging and launch processes, eliminating the need for on-site pilots.

Edge AI Computer Vision: Next-generation platforms will process image recognition natively on the UAV. This reduces bandwidth requirements by transmitting only actionable defect coordinates instead of continuous raw video feeds.

Hybrid Energy Systems: Solid-state batteries and hydrogen fuel cells are beginning to replace traditional LiPo configurations. This helps commercial missions exceed 3-hour flight times under typical conditions.

What is the advantage of using carbon fiber structures in industrial agriculture and surveying?
High-strength carbon fiber significantly reduces the empty weight of the drone frame while maintaining excellent structural rigidity. For agricultural sprayers like the AL4-50, carbon fiber provides crucial protection against chemical corrosion, extending the operational life of the system compared to plastic or aluminum alloys.
How does a dynamic battery swap station like the GUD K01 improve commercial operations?
The GUD K01 Dock Kit automates the battery-swapping process. When a drone lands on the docking guide, the station automatically removes the depleted battery pack and inserts a fully charged one. This setup enables continuous, scheduled surveillance patrols or site mappings without requiring human operators on site.
Can the telemetry communication system resist RF interference in heavy industrial areas?
Yes, our UAV systems use advanced FHSS (Frequency Hopping Spread Spectrum) alongside dual-channel or triple-channel redundancy configurations. This ensures reliable command links even when operating near high-voltage lines, substation transformers, or metropolitan communications towers.
